"chapel of rest" meaning in English

See chapel of rest in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Forms: chapels of rest [plural]
Head templates: {{en-noun|chapels of rest}} chapel of rest (plural chapels of rest)
  1. An undertaker's room where the body of the deceased is kept prior to burial or disposal. Categories (topical): Rooms
